The Current State of Identification in Denmark


Denmark has actually long been at the forefront of embracing digital innovation in civil services, with its NemID system functioning as the foundation for online recognition and finalizing. NemID permits Danish residents to access a wide variety of services, from banking to government applications, with a secure and user-friendly interface. However, as the crypto landscape evolves, so too does the need for a secure confirmation technique that accommodates the distinct qualities of digital currencies.
